Output 3d7b23940f2ab74609f1613a8820850c2b3bd2dab7fe717bae38ed68756af2f1:1

value
800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911f150979fdbf1ac60861848fb10c738e877645 OP_EQUAL
address
3EvM8zBBrEETcygDWxUoMKtMmop6VTXBeS
transaction
3d7b23940f2ab74609f1613a8820850c2b3bd2dab7fe717bae38ed68756af2f1
spent
true